How good are analogue hall sensors as a form of position control?

How good are analogue hall sensors as a form of position control? Has anyone had experience with these?

Such analog halls are used as sin/cose encoder inside Servo Tube motors allowing reach resolution down to tens um by internal interpolation inside Copley digital drives.

Thanks for your comment. As the signals are interpolated, what kind of repeatability is possible? With all interpolated encoder methods there is this issue as the counts are not "real!" like an optical encoder.

ServoTube motors' manufacturer declines 12um resolution, +/-12um repeatability with absolute accuracy +/-350um as max error over 1m. Yes such analog Halls have lower accuracy due to higher pitch (51.2mm vs. 20um with optical linear encoders) and poor shapes. But you can use Position Error mapping by motion controller for increase servo accuracy as well.
